London, UK. 20th June 2017 - On 14 June 2017 Grenfell Tower, a 24-storey high tower block of public housing flats in North Kensington, west London, England was severely damaged by fire, causing a high number of casualties. People have come to lay flowers and pay tributes to the victims who lost their lives in the fire.

- Image ID: JDM3BN

Similar stock images